Mulch Self Improver โ€” Let your agents grow ๐ŸŒฑ

Structured expertise that accumulates over time, lives in git, and works with any agent. Agents start each session from zero; the pattern discovered yesterday is forgotten today. This skill uses Mulch: agents call mulch record to write learnings and mulch query to read them. Expertise compounds across sessions, domains, and teammates. Mulch is a passive layer โ€” it does not contain an LLM. Agents use Mulch; Mulch does not use agents.

Benefits: Better and more consistent coding ยท Improved experience ยท Less hallucination (grounding in project expertise)

When to use: Command/tool fails, user corrects you, user wants a missing feature, your knowledge was wrong, or you found a better approach โ€” record with Mulch and promote proven patterns to project memory. Auto-detection: The hook now detects errors and corrections automatically and prompts to record.

Mechanics: One learning store โ€” .mulch/ (append-only JSONL, git-tracked, queryable). Session start: mulch prime. Recording: mulch record <domain> --type <type> .... No .learnings/ markdown files.

Record Types (Mulch)

TypeRequiredUse Case
failuredescription, resolutionWhat went wrong and how to avoid it
conventioncontent"Use pnpm not npm"; "Always WAL mode for SQLite"
patternname, descriptionNamed patterns, optional --file
decisiontitle, rationaleArchitecture, tech choices, feature tracking
referencename, descriptionKey files, endpoints, resources
guidename, descriptionStep-by-step procedures

Optional on any record: --classification (foundational | tactical | observational), --tags, --relates-to, --supersedes, --evidence-commit, --evidence-file, --outcome-status (success | failure).

Workflow

  1. Session start: If .mulch/ exists, run mulch prime (or mulch prime <domain> for focus).
  2. During work: When something fails or you learn something, run mulch record <domain> --type <type> ....
  3. Before finishing: Review; record any remaining insights with mulch record.
  4. Promote: When a pattern is proven and broadly applicable, add to CLAUDE.md / AGENTS.md / SOUL.md / TOOLS.md; use mulch onboard to generate snippets.

Finding Domain

  • Use existing domains from mulch status or mulch query --all.
  • Run mulch learn to get domain suggestions from changed files.
  • Common domains: api, database, testing, frontend, backend, infra, docs, config.

Recurring Patterns and Linking

  • Search first: mulch search "keyword" or mulch query <domain>.
  • Link records: mulch record ... --relates-to <domain>:<id> or --supersedes <domain>:<id>.
  • Recurring issues โ†’ promote to CLAUDE.md/AGENTS.md or add to TOOLS.md/SOUL.md so all agents see them.

Multi-Agent Safety

Mulch is safe for concurrent use: advisory file locking, atomic writes, and merge=union in .gitattributes for JSONL. Multiple agents can run mulch prime and mulch record in parallel; locks serialize writes per domain.

Best Practices

  1. Record immediately โ€” context is freshest after the issue.
  2. Pick the right type โ€” failure (description+resolution), convention (short rule), decision (title+rationale), etc.
  3. Use domains consistently โ€” e.g. same api domain for all API-related learnings.
  4. Link related records โ€” --relates-to, --supersedes.
  5. Run mulch prime at session start โ€” so the agent is grounded in existing expertise.
  6. Promote when proven โ€” move broadly applicable rules to CLAUDE.md, AGENTS.md, SOUL.md, TOOLS.md.

No .learnings/

This skill does not use .learnings/ or markdown log files. All learnings live in .mulch/ and are recorded via the Mulch CLI. If you see references to .learnings/ in older docs, treat them as superseded by Mulch.
